What SIA Thinks

Pivotal Tracker is a project management tool designed to help teams collaborate more effectively and deliver high-quality software. Its straightforward, intuitive interface makes tracking progress on projects easy, ensuring everyone stays on the same page. The platform is structured around user stories, which break down projects into manageable parts and help keep the focus on what really needs to be done.

One of the standout features of Pivotal Tracker is its real-time updates. As tasks are completed or priorities shift, the progress is automatically reflected for everyone on the team. This minimizes the need for constant check-ins and status meetings, letting team members concentrate on their work.

Pivotal Tracker also includes helpful visual tools like charts and boards. These tools provide a clear overview of what's been accomplished and what's coming up next. By making project status transparent and visible, everyone from project managers to developers can easily understand the current state of a project and plan accordingly.

Prioritization is another key aspect of Pivotal Tracker. Teams can rank tasks based on their importance and urgency, ensuring the most critical items are addressed first. The platform also supports iteration planning, allowing teams to organize their work into regular, manageable cycles. This approach helps in maintaining a steady pace of development and makes it easier to keep track of progress over time.

Furthermore, Pivotal Tracker offers seamless integrations with other tools that teams are likely already using. This compatibility allows for a more cohesive workflow, reducing the friction that can come from switching between different applications.

Overall, Pivotal Tracker simplifies the process of managing and completing projects. It's designed to be user-friendly and efficient, making it a reliable choice for teams looking to improve their project management practices.
